What is a Superconducting Nanowire Single-Photon Detector (SNSPD)?


SNSPDs   represent cutting-edge photon detection technology that leverages superconducting nanowires cooled to cryogenic temperatures (typically below 4K) to achieve unprecedented detection capabilities. Unlike conventional photodetectors, SNSPDs can:

  • Detect single photons with   >90% efficiency
  • Maintain exceptionally low dark count rates (<1 Hz)
  • Offer picosecond-level timing resolution
  • Operate across visible to near-infrared wavelengths

The technology works by maintaining a superconducting nanowire just below its critical temperature. When a photon strikes the nanowire, it creates a localized hotspot that momentarily drives the nanowire into a resistive state, generating a measurable electrical pulse.

Market Challenges


Despite their benefits, several factors currently limit broader SNSPD adoption:

  • Complex cryogenic requirements : Maintaining the necessary operating temperatures (typically using liquid helium or cryocoolers) adds significant cost and complexity.

  • Manufacturing costs : The specialized materials (niobium nitride or tungsten silicide) and cleanroom fabrication processes keep unit prices high.

  • Technology maturity : As a relatively new technology (first demonstrated in 2001), SNSPDs still face integration challenges with existing optical systems.

What is a Paper Machine Headbox?


The   Paper Machine Headbox   serves as the heart of the papermaking process, responsible for uniformly distributing fiber slurry across the forming fabric. This critical component determines the basis weight profile and formation quality of the final paper product. Modern headboxes utilize advanced hydraulic systems and turbulence generators to optimize fiber orientation and minimize defects.

Contemporary headbox designs fall into three primary categories:   open type   (traditional approach),   air-cushioned   (for improved control), and   hydraulic   (for high-speed machines). What are Single Use Valves?


Single use valves are   disposable components designed for one-time application   in fluid management systems. These valves eliminate cross-contamination risks in   pharmaceuticals ,   biotech , and   food processing   by removing the need for cleaning validation. Major types include   diaphragm valves ,   pinch valves , and   check valves , offering sterility assurance in single-use bioprocessing systems.

Standardization Gaps to Hinder Cross-Industry Adoption

Despite IEC 60751 establishing baseline specifications, implementation variations across regions create compatibility challenges for global manufacturers. North American facilities typically prefer 0.00385 Ω/Ω/°C alpha coefficient sensors, while some Asian markets utilize 0.003916 Ω/Ω/°C standards, requiring costly inventory diversification. The lack of universal protocols for smart sensor data communication further complicates large-scale deployments.

Other Challenges

Competition from Alternative Technologies
Advanced semiconductor temperature sensors now match PT100 accuracy in narrower ranges (-55°C to +150°C) while offering digital outputs and lower costs, capturing market share in consumer electronics and HVAC applications.

Miniaturization Barriers
Shrinking sensor footprints while maintaining calibration stability remains technically challenging, limiting penetration into microelectronics and compact medical devices where space constraints dominate design considerations.

What are Radial Agriculture Tires?


Radial agriculture tires   represent a significant advancement over traditional bias-ply tires, featuring steel belts arranged perpendicularly to the direction of travel for optimized performance. These specialized tires are engineered for heavy-duty agricultural machinery including   tractors, harvesters, and sprayers , offering distinct operational advantages:

  • Enhanced load distribution   that reduces soil compaction by up to 30% compared to bias-ply alternatives
  • Superior traction performance   through flexible sidewalls that conform to uneven terrain
  • Fuel savings of 8-12%   due to lower rolling resistance
  • Extended service life   with tread wear patterns lasting 20% longer than conventional tires

The technology has become particularly crucial for modern precision farming operations where minimizing soil impact and optimizing equipment efficiency directly correlate with crop yields and operational costs.
